L.A. Mayoral Race: Pratt and Raman Challenge Bass in Fundraising

Key Insights

  • **Fundraising Leaders:** Spencer Pratt has raised nearly $540,000 since January 1, closely followed by Nithya Raman with $530,000.
  • **Bass's Cash on Hand:** Karen Bass has collected nearly $495,000 this year and has approximately $2.3 million in cash on hand.
  • **Miller's Self-Funding:** Tech entrepreneur Adam Miller loaned his campaign $2.5 million.
  • **Impact of Matching Funds:** Raman has benefited significantly from the city's matching funds program, boosting her total proceeds.
  • **Outside Spending in District 11:** The race for District 11 City Council member sees substantial outside spending, with support for incumbent Traci Park and challenger Faizah Malik.

In-Depth Analysis

The latest fundraising reports reveal a competitive financial landscape in the L.A. mayoral race. Pratt and Raman's strong fundraising numbers indicate growing momentum, while Bass relies on her existing war chest and broader donor network. Adam Miller's self-funding strategy sets him apart, but his polling numbers remain low.

The nonpartisan nature of the race means candidates must appeal to a broad spectrum of voters. The ability to purchase television advertising, social media ads, and other campaign essentials will be critical in the final weeks leading up to the primary. With a significant percentage of voters still undecided, the financial resources of each campaign could play a decisive role.

In other citywide races, incumbents and challengers are also engaged in competitive fundraising efforts. The City Attorney and City Controller races showcase the importance of financial backing in securing victory.
